[0005] In short, if the pump truck using the high-altitude lifting device has the following series of disadvantages: insufficient height, complex system, limited lifting height of the lifting device (self-weight, strength and elasticity of the material itself), large and heavy system, and the lifting The device is too complicated and too heavy, so the ground vehicle is also very heavy, sacrificing the water load capacity, and the deployment time is longer, and the maneuverability is weak

[0007] 4. Helicopter rescue: Although helicopter fire extinguishing has good maneuverability and a wide range of applications, it is expensive and has limited load capacity. It cannot achieve continuous water supply. The water supply cycle is long and the use cost is high.
It mainly uses large-area indiscriminate spraying, the efficiency is not high, the impact on the surrounding area is greater, and the practicability for fire extinguishing inside the floors of high-rise buildings is not strong.

Embodiment Construction

[0025] The present invention will be further described in detail below in conjunction with the accompanying drawings and specific embodiments.

[0026] Such as figure 1 and figure 2 As shown, the high-altitude fixed-point continuous water spraying device based on a hot air balloon of the present invention includes a hot air balloon body 1 and a ground control assembly 2, and the ground control assembly 2 includes a traction control mechanism 201, power supply equipment, water supply equipment, monitoring equipment, and a main controller etc. The hot air balloon body 1 is provided with a directional water spray assembly 3 in the air, and the directional water spray assembly 3 in the air is connected with the control assembly 2 on the ground and can be controlled by the control assembly 2 on the ground. Abstract

The invention discloses an overhead fixed-point continuous water spraying device based on a hot air balloon. The device comprises a hot air balloon body and a ground control assembly, wherein the ground control assembly comprises traction control mechanisms, power supply equipment, water supply equipment, monitoring equipment and a main controller; the hot air balloon body is connected with the traction control mechanisms by traction ropes; an aerial directional water spraying assembly is arranged on the hot air balloon body and is connected with and controlled by the ground control assembly. The device has the advantages of simple and compact structure, low cost, wide application range, good controllability, good fire extinguishment efficiency and the like.

technical field [0001] The invention mainly relates to the field of water spraying equipment, in particular to a high-altitude fixed-point water spraying device mainly suitable for fire protection and other fields. Background technique [0002] At present, common high-altitude fire fighting and rescue methods mainly include the following: [0003] 1. Manual fire extinguishing and rescue: Although this rescue method has high accuracy, it requires rescuers to go deep into the fire scene, and the risk factor is high, causing a large number of casualties. Especially for fire scenes located at high or super high positions. [0004] 2.
